As you didn't receive a Notice to Owner you have grounds for making a Statutory for making a Statutory Out of Time Declaration. You can obtain the form from here. You need to get it witnessed by a comissioner of oath/officer of the court etc. This can be done for free at your local court.

 

If this is accepted then it will halt the enforcement proceedings and the bailiff. A notice to owner will be re-issued giving you 28 days to either pay it or (albeit it wont be at the reduce rate) or appeal it.

 

You can also use the time to obtain the a breakdown of the bailiffs charges as they are only allowed to charge set amounts.

 

You should also PM one of our CAG members Tomtubby and ask for her help. She can check that the bailiff is registered and also advise on the charges.

This question should really be on the bailiff forum. Can you send me aPM with the nam eof the actual bailiff so that I can search to ensure that he is certificated.

 

You have made the correct choice in filing an Out of Time. We do many of these each day at our office and we always recommend that you send an e-mail to the bailiff co to advise them of this application.

 

In the meantime you should write to the bailiff co to ask for a copy of the screen shot of your account as you have concerns about the level of charges applied to your account. By LAW they MUST provide one.
